Transaction 608716016890ff73cfe34d4bc11e7699c4ea24a064fac6ff719edab4a36bf561

1 Input
2 Outputs
  • 608716016890ff73cfe34d4bc11e7699c4ea24a064fac6ff719edab4a36bf561:0
  • value  1043935
    address  38XhFYgv8UeGhnxiWijhmiAbzM6x3xA683
  • 608716016890ff73cfe34d4bc11e7699c4ea24a064fac6ff719edab4a36bf561:1
  • value  273663
    address  bc1qmau4w54gm8nhdtexye9lwxw7354uu260hwvx6s